TotalEnergies is one of the largest providers of on street charge points in London, maintaining a network of over 3000 charge points with a planned rise to 6000 by 2030, and a reliability rate of 97%. The network and maintenance team will grow, and the complexity of maintenance delivery will increase as different models of charge point coexist and as DC is introduced with different management rules. Each site has a feeder pillar and between 1 and 5 charge points, mostly located curb side on public streets, allowing EV users to park and charge in any bay with its dedicated charge point. The charge points require regular supervision, monitoring, and maintenance to provide the best charging experience for our customers.
